How Many Bonds Can Silicon Form
How Many Bonds Can Silicon Form - Silicon has the same valence configuration as carbon, so like carbon it forms 4 bonds. Hydrogen makes 1 bond, oxygen makes 2 bonds, nitrogen makes 3 bonds and carbon makes 4 bonds. Web the element silicon would be expected to form 4 covalent bond (s) in order to obey the octet rule.
